What Kinds of Bikes Does Merida Offer?

Merida, as a brand, has been quite busy making all sorts of bikes for a really wide range of people. You know, if you're just thinking about getting into cycling, maybe trying out a mountain bike for the first time on some gentle trails, or perhaps a road bike for rides around your neighborhood, they have options that are pretty welcoming. They're built to be easy to get along with, so you can just enjoy the ride without too much fuss. It's almost like they want to make sure everyone feels comfortable starting their cycling journey, no matter how new they are to it all.

Then again, for those who take their cycling quite seriously, like the folks who compete in big, important races, the kind you see on TV, Merida also makes bikes for them. These are the machines that are put through their paces on the world stage, built for speed and endurance, where every little bit of engineering can make a difference. It's a bit like having a car manufacturer that makes both everyday family cars and also builds super-fast race cars; they cover the whole spectrum. So, whether you're pedaling for fun or for a podium spot, there's a Merida bike that's, you know, pretty much ready for you.

They actually feature some really well-known models that people often talk about. For instance, there's the Scultura, which is a popular road bike, often chosen for its balance and comfortable ride. Then there's the Reacto, which is more about going fast, designed to cut through the air. And for those who like to mix things up, maybe ride on paved roads one day and gravel paths the next, the Silex is a bike that tends to be a favorite. Beyond these, they also have a good number of electric bikes, or E-bikes, which are, you know, quite popular right now. These E-bikes are offered under the Miyata brand, making it easier for more people to enjoy cycling with a little bit of help from the motor.

How Does Merida Build Such High-Quality Bikes?

When you're talking about bike frames, especially those made from carbon, the way they're put together makes a really big difference in how the bike performs. Merida, it seems, pays very close attention to this. They've actually found a way to make their carbon frames even better by using something called nanotechnology. You know, it sounds a bit fancy, but it basically means they're working with incredibly tiny materials to improve the frame's strength and overall quality. This kind of attention to the little details is what sets some bike makers apart.

What they do is, they mix a special kind of material, made with nanotechnology, into the epoxy that's used when they shape the carbon tubes. Epoxy is the glue, essentially, that holds the carbon fibers together. By adding this nanotechnology material, they're able to make the structure of the carbon tubes even stronger and more consistent. It's almost like reinforcing the building blocks of the frame at a microscopic level, making the whole thing more durable and, you know, better able to handle the stresses of riding.

This process is about making sure the carbon frames are not just light, which carbon is known for, but also incredibly strong and reliable. It means that when you're out riding, whether you're hitting bumps on a trail or sprinting on the road, the frame is going to hold up well and give you a solid feel. This commitment to using advanced materials and precise manufacturing methods is, in some respects, a big part of why Merida bikes are known for their quality. They're always looking for ways to improve the fundamental parts of their bikes.
